epub words glue together

Hello,

In all my epubs, I noticed that in some lines there is no more space between words and so, they are glued together, like one word. Any idea of the option I have to modify to get that right ?

I also noticed that happens only on the lines which follow an hyphen like this (in french) :

«*sensation fraîches d’un homme de la cam-
pagneet je ne pouvais me résigner à rompre*»

Could it be related to the & shy ; hyphens presents in some of my epubs ?

Hi Ken,
The french hyph dic seems to run alright on koreader (and i mean very alright - far better than the nickel one) when there is no shy hyphen. But to resolve a lot of issues with hyphen on nickel I had the habit to put shy hyphens on nearly all my books and disable the algorithm (using the hyphenate this plugin with calibre). It’s not really a problem to remove them (just a matter of time). And it really seems to be the source of the problem. No reader seems to ignore them (the shy char) at this time. With soft hyphen the dictionary searches are broken on nickel - and on korearder, it’s the space between words (but i don’t really need a french dictionary anyway). You don't need soft hyphens with your Kobo. What you need to do to get better hyphenation results is to look at the hyphenation dictionary and see the settings in the hyphenation dictionary is too big (like it is with the US hyphenation dictionary) and fix it.

The problem is that
Code:
LEFTHYPHENMIN 5
RIGHTHYPHENMIN 5
(US default setting) is too large and thus, you don't get hyphenation except on really big words. I have mine set both to 2 and it works much better. I'm guessing the Frenchdictionary could be just as misconfigured.

I agree with you on this.
- Koreader has a much better PDF reader than the one we find by default on the Kindle.
- For EPUB, it suffers from some defects (some missing css properties, an uncomplete image display) but gives good service for most of the books except the most complex ones.

For these reasons, when I have a complex EPUB to read (with an intricate display, many images of different kinds, etc.), I have rather converting it with one click as a six inches PDF with the Prince PDF plugin we find with Sigil (which also provides excellent hyphenation): just open the EPUB with Sigil, menu "Greffon/Sortie/Prince PDF and you have it. Then, the css display is the most precise and complete I know of.

This solution though can't be generalized because the font-family, line-height and font-size values can't later be modified but it may be perfect if it fits your personal reading choices. So it's a personal solution not a general one.
